How Does a Supercharger Enhance Performance in a Challenger?

A supercharger enhances performance in a Challenger by forcing more air into the engine, resulting in increased power output and efficiency.

  • Increased Airflow: A supercharger compresses the incoming air, which allows for a greater volume of air to enter the engine. This increased airflow leads to more fuel being burned, which significantly boosts horsepower and torque.
  • Immediate Power Boost: Unlike turbochargers that rely on exhaust gases to spool up, superchargers provide a direct power boost as they are mechanically driven by the engine’s crankshaft. This means that the power is available almost instantaneously, enhancing acceleration and responsiveness.
  • Improved Engine Efficiency: By enriching the air-fuel mixture, superchargers improve combustion efficiency. This allows the engine to produce more power without needing to increase its displacement, ultimately leading to better performance without compromising fuel efficiency.
  • Variety of Types: There are different types of superchargers, such as roots, twin-screw, and centrifugal, each with unique characteristics. For example, roots superchargers provide strong low-end torque, while centrifugal superchargers deliver more power at higher RPMs, allowing drivers to choose the best option for their performance needs.
  • Enhanced Sound and Driving Experience: Superchargers can produce a distinctive whine or roar that many enthusiasts find appealing. This auditory feedback enhances the overall driving experience, making the Challenger feel more powerful and engaging on the road.

What Types of Superchargers Are Available for the Challenger?

When considering superchargers for the Dodge Challenger, various options cater to different performance needs and driving styles. The main types of superchargers available are:

  • Roots Superchargers: Known for their high boost and immediate throttle response, Roots superchargers are perfect for street driving. They provide consistent power but can be limited in top-end performance. Popular brands for Roots superchargers on the Challenger include Edelbrock and Magnuson.

  • Twin-Screw Superchargers: These offer better efficiency and cooler intake temperatures. They surpass Roots in power output, making them suitable for high-performance applications. Notable examples include the Whipple and Kenne Bell superchargers, which are favored for their impressive gains and durability.

  • Centrifugal Superchargers: Renowned for high RPM power and better fuel efficiency, centrifugal superchargers, such as those from Vortech and ProCharger, are ideal for racers looking for a high-top-end performance increase. They provide a gradual boost, making them less reactive at low speeds compared to Roots or Twin-Screw models.

Each type has unique advantages, and the choice often depends on specific desired outcomes and vehicle modifications.

What Are the Top Brands for Challenger Superchargers?

The top brands for Challenger superchargers include:

  • Whipple Superchargers: Known for their high-performance superchargers, Whipple offers a range of kits for the Dodge Challenger that significantly increase horsepower and torque. Their twin-screw design is engineered for maximum efficiency and power, making them a popular choice among enthusiasts looking for reliable performance boosts.
  • Edelbrock: Edelbrock superchargers are renowned for their ease of installation and impressive performance gains. Their products often include a complete package with everything needed for installation, along with a focus on maintaining drivability and reliability, making them suitable for both street and track applications.
  • Magnuson Superchargers: Magnuson specializes in roots-type superchargers that provide instant throttle response and substantial power increases across the RPM range. Their supercharger kits are designed for durability and are often praised for their high-quality manufacturing and performance consistency.
  • Procharger: Procharger is well-known for its centrifugal superchargers, which are capable of producing massive horsepower while maintaining a factory-like driving experience. Their systems are particularly effective for those seeking high-end power without sacrificing everyday usability.
  • Vortech Superchargers: Vortech offers a range of centrifugal superchargers that are designed to improve performance while keeping noise levels low. Their supercharger systems are popular for their tunability and ability to fit a variety of performance goals, from mild upgrades to full-on racing setups.

What Installation Considerations Should You Keep in Mind?

When installing the best Challenger supercharger, several key considerations are essential for optimal performance and reliability.

  • Compatibility: Ensure that the supercharger is compatible with your specific Challenger model and engine type. Different models may have unique engine configurations, necessitating specific supercharger kits designed to work seamlessly with them.
  • Installation Location: Choose an appropriate location for the installation that allows for easy access and proper airflow. A well-ventilated area will help maintain optimal operating temperatures and ensure that the supercharger functions efficiently.
  • Supporting Modifications: Consider any additional modifications that may be required to support the supercharger’s installation, such as upgraded fuel injectors or intercoolers. These components help manage the increased power and heat generated by the supercharger, ensuring the engine runs smoothly.
  • Tuning Requirements: Proper tuning is critical after installation to optimize performance and prevent engine damage. A professional tune can adjust the air-fuel mixture and ignition timing, maximizing the benefits of the supercharger while maintaining engine reliability.
  • Warranty and Legal Compliance: Check the warranty implications and compliance with local emissions regulations before installation. Some supercharger kits may void manufacturer warranties or may not meet legal standards in certain regions.
  • Cooling Systems: Evaluate whether additional cooling systems are necessary to handle the extra heat generated by the supercharger. Enhanced cooling solutions, like upgraded radiators or oil coolers, can help maintain optimal engine temperatures during performance driving.
  • Budget Considerations: Factor in the total cost of the supercharger installation, including the kit, labor, and any additional modifications. It’s important to create a budget that covers all aspects of the installation process to avoid unexpected expenses.
